Skylight Leak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ak (less than 1 inch of water) Yes No You can handle small leaks yourself with a wet vacuum and some towels.
Large leak (more than 1 inch of water) No Yes Large leaks need spec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age.
Visible mold growth No Yes Mold growth needs professional removal to prevent health risks and ensure a safe living environment.
Water damage in a large area (more than 10 square feet) No Yes Large areas of water damage need spec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further problems.
Unknown source of the leak No Yes An unknown source of the leak needs professional investigation and repair to prevent further damage.

Skylight Leak Water Removal Cost in Hyattsville, MD

The cost of skylight leak water removal in Hyattsville, MD, var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. The prices below are estimates and may vary based on your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Inspection and Assessment $100 – $500 Size of affected area, complexity of damage
Containment and Water Extraction $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, amount of water present
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, amount of time required for drying
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ning solution required
Repair and Re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, complexity of repair
